Operation Podcast presents Ruben Rojas, a Los Angeles based artist, designer, speaker, and entrepreneur who uses art to inspire others to see through the lens of LOVE. Live Through Love is a way of life. Living through love is an active choice from the heart. It may be much easier to live in gloom and act from fear, but when you live through love, life is so much more beautiful.  If you’re seeking a change in perspective and want more love in all areas of your life, this is for you. About the guest: Jesse Israel is a social entrepreneur, meditation leader and former record label executive known for founding the mass meditation movement The Big Quiet. He has signed multi-platinum bands like MGMT, led some of the largest meditations in the world, given keynotes at Fortune 100s and teach meditation to global leaders. He has run corporate meditation sessions for companies like Adidas, Google and Ford, and have spoken at places like Madison Square Garden, Coca Cola HQ and Parsons School of Design.

About the guest: Rosie Acosta is the author of You Are Radically Loved: A Healing Journey to Self-Love, has studied yoga and mindfulness for more than 20 years, and taught for over a decade. She hosts a weekly conversational wellness podcast called, The Radically Loved Podcast. She works with a wide range of students, from those in her East Los Angeles community to Olympic athletes, NFL champions, NBA All-Stars and veterans of war. A first-gen Mexican-American, Rosie’s mission is to help others overcome adversity and experience radical love.

About the guest: Eben Britton is a former American football offensive tackle who played six seasons in the National Football League. Selected 39th overall in the 2009 NFL Draft, he spent four years with the Jacksonville Jaguars followed by two with the Chicago Bears, last playing football in 2014

About the guest: Over the past sixty years, Dr. Gladys McGarey, MD has pioneered a new way of thinking about disease and health that has transformed the way we imagine health care and self-care around the world. The cofounder of the American Holistic Medical Association, Dr. McGarey has mentored everyone from Dr. Mark Hyman to Dr. Edith Eger and has helped hundreds of patients live happier and healthier lives.

About the Guest: Humble The Poet (Kanwer Mahl) is a Canadian-born artist, rapper, spoken-word poet, international best-selling author, and former elementary school teacher with a wildly popular blog with over 100,000 monthly readers. He is the author of “Unlearn”, “Things No One Else Can Teach Us”, and most recently, “How to Be Love(d)”. Humble has performed at concerts and festivals, including Lollapalooza and has been featured in major media including The New York Times, BuzzFeed, Vogue, Rolling Stones, and Huffington Post.

About the guest: Joy Taylor is an American media personality and television host for Fox Sports 1. She is currently the co-host of Speak with LeSean McCoy and Emmanuel Acho. Taylor was the news update anchor on Fox Sports 1's The Herd with Colin Cowherd, and the host of The Joy Taylor Show Saturdays on Fox Sports Radio
